CPC G06F 8/20 (2013.01) [G06F 8/38 (2013.01); G06F 16/285 (2019.01); H04L 67/535 (2022.05); G06F 3/0485 (2013.01); G06F 3/0486 (2013.01)] | 19 Claims |
1. A method for tracking usability of an application, the method comprising:
receiving, by a processor, an input to track the usability of the application during a usage session;
listening, by the processor, for one or more input events associated with the application and broadcast by an operating system on which the application is being executed, wherein the one or more events correspond to an application function;
capturing, by the processor, data associated with the one or more input events, wherein the data comprises one or more of cursor travel distance and cursor travel between clicks;
storing, by the processor, the data associated with the one or more input events in a local storage device, wherein the data associated with the one or more input events is correlated to the usage session and the application function in the local storage device; and
transmitting, by the processor, the data associated with the one or more input events to a central hub.
|